Scariest couple of days of my life
Jennifer has just come out of hospital with a possible bacterial infection.
She was very snuffly for a couple of days then had a slightly raised temperature on Sunday eve, but not enough to warrent a+e, Then on monday she had really dark green poo, and very runny. When we called nhs direct they said its probably nothing, but to take her to a+e anyway, She had two more really disgusting bubbly almost black nappies and they decided to keep her in investigate as shes so young. She had a canula put in which was really really horrible for her and me, then suddenly went really pale and floppy and her eyes rolled back in her head, i almost screamed the house down, but the nurse seemed to think she was ok, and hooked her up to IV fluids and anti biotics. The sight of her little arm with the canula in made me want to just burst into tears. She also had to have a lumber puncture and a snot swab (suction tube up the nose) all really horrible proceedures poor little mite.
Anyway, shes home now, back in tomorrow for a top up of anti biotics. Nappys are still quite gross, but getting better. Please just take good care of your little ones, dont hesitate to take them into a+e - i hate to think of what might have happened if we'd waited. Get a digital under arm thermometer, not an ear one.
